      <description>I am not sure which driver (esctl or esdisk) is responsible for multipathing (may be both of them) but you can find the driver versions by:&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;# what /stand/vmunix | grep -E 'esctl|esdisk'&lt;BR /&gt;         esctl - /ux/core/kern/common/io/escsi/services/esctl.c:Jan 14 2010,22:49:05&lt;BR /&gt;         esctl.c $Date: 2009/05/31 03:06:26 $Revision: r11.31/7 PATCH_11.31 (B11.31.0909LR)&lt;BR /&gt;         $Revision: esctl:    B11.31.1003LR &lt;BR /&gt;         $Revision: esdisk:    B11.31.1003LR</description>

      <description>Hello Shashi,&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;NMP in 11iv3 is not implemented in a particular driver. Rather it is part of the 11iv3 SCSI stack. In other words, it is built in.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;If you still want to know the version, then I'd say it is the Fusion release of the HP-UX. So, 11.31 Fusion 1003 for the March 2010 release, etc.</description>
